/// \brief An interface to provide a PROMELA front-end.
|
|
///
|
|
/// This interface let to use a Promela model as a Büchi automata.
|
|
/// It uses the NIPS library, which provied a virtual machine for
|
|
/// the state-space exploration of a Promela model, therefore, models
|
|
/// must be compiled with the NIPS compiler
|
|
/// (http://wwwhome.cs.utwente.nl/~michaelw/nips/).
|
|
///
|
|
/// With this interface, properties to check aren't defined with the Spot LTL
|
|
/// representation, but in defining correctness claims (a monitor) in the
|
|
/// Promela model (see chapter 4, The Spin Model Checker: Primer and
|
|
/// reference manual, Gerard J.Holzmann).
